CVE-2022-49284
Medium 5.5
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: coresight: syscfg: Fix memleak on registration failure in cscfg_create_device device_register() calls device_initialize(), according to doc of device_initialize: Use put_device() to give up your reference instead of freeing * @dev directly once you have called this function. To prevent potential memleak, use put_device() for error handling.
Affected products and versions
| linux | linux_kernel · 5.15 → 5.15.33 |
|---|---|
| linux | linux_kernel · 5.16 → 5.16.19 |
| linux | linux_kernel · 5.17 → 5.17.2 |
